Do you have the technical qualifications?

  • Required Skills:
    • 8+ years of hands‑on experience with IBM Sterling B2B Integrator (SI), including map development, business process modeling, trading partner setup, and troubleshooting.
    • Skilled in managing relationships with both internal stakeholders (executive leadership, cross-functional teams) and external customers (clients, partners, vendors).
    • Strong proficiency with EDI ANSI X12 and EDIFACT standards, including transaction sets, schemas, and partner compliance requirements.
    • Deep understanding of communication protocols such as FTP/SFTP, AS2, HTTP/S, and certificate‑based authentication.
    • Expertise in Business Process (BP) development, debugging, and EDI map creation.
    • Proficiency with Direct EDI, EDI via VAN, and Web EDI methodologies.
    • Strong experience with SQL for data analysis, lookups, error investigation, and reporting. 
  • Preferred Skills:
    • Experience as part of a production support team managing an enterprise‑scale EDI platform, including investigation and resolution of EDI‑related issues in coordination with internal teams and external trading partners.
    • Strong knowledge of the EDI (Electronic Data Interchange) Incident Management Life Cycle, including detection, logging, categorization, prioritization, investigation, resolution, and closure.
    • Experience coordinating and executing security certificate updates, SSL/TLS configurations, and key management.
    • Experience with Sterling Integrator administration, including deployments, patching, performance tuning, and system monitoring.
    • Familiarity with Sterling File Gateway (SFG), Sterling Secure Proxy (SSP), and Sterling Control Center (SCC).
    • Experience with Lightwell frameworks or Pragma Community Manager for partner onboarding and governance.
    • Experience working on migration or upgrade initiatives.
